LAKES ENTRANCE FIRE BRIGADE
BIENNIAL ELECTION RESULTS 2026-2028

Captain - Phil Loukes
1st Lieutenant - Ryan Fordham
2nd Lieutenant - Chris Verrall
3rd Lieutenant - Geof Bassett
4th Lieutenant - Steve Weidemann

Communications Officer - Jaime Escudero
Secretary - Ian Ashcroft
Treasurer - Lesley Garth

The brigade would like to thank all outgoing officers and delegates for their dedication, service and contribution. We also congratulate the newly elected members and wish them every success in their roles over the coming term.

Please note: these election results are subject to CFA ACFO approval and will not take effect until 1 July 2026.

The Fire Danger Period has been amended for the pictured municipalities, and will now be lifted as of 1:00am Tuesday 7 April 2026.

However, residents are reminded to make themselves familiar with local council regulations and bylaws.
The burning of plastics and other synthetic materials are not permitted and is enforced all year round. Hefty penalties from Council and/or the EPA may apply

“You light it, you own it.”

FIRE CALL ON REMOTE NORTH ARM BEACH 🔥

Early this morning at about 7am your local volunteer fire brigade members responded to what was initially called in as an abandoned campfire. Located a short walk down from the end of Capes Road on some lake frontage.

When fire crews located the fire they soon discovered how lucky we are that the weather wasn’t any worse.

It would appear that a boat has presumably made landfall and dumped a large pile of rubbish, including fibreglass, aresol cans, foam, timber and even a large truck battery and then set alight some time in the early hours of this morning!

The fire as a result has spread along the coastal foreshore to be about 25m in length. Thankfully the scrub in this section was thin enough to not support fire spread any further than it did. If it were thicker and warmer weather this could’ve been a completely different story!

This type of behaviour is completely unacceptable and consequences could be dire as a result. Particularly with the last 2 days being declared Total Fire Bans in our district and warm weather forecast in the coming days.

The brigade urge members of the public to contact CrimeStoppers on 1800 333 000 if you have any information in relation to this fire.
